President Muhammadu Buhari has approved the review of the National Broadcasting Code and extant broadcasting laws to reflect stiffer punishment for broadcasting regulations.
The Minister of Information and Culture, Alhaji lai Mohammed disclosed this while inaugurating the National broadcasting Commission reform Implementation Commitee.
Specifically, the minister said that the President approved the upward review of fine from N500,000 t0 N5 million for breaches relating to hate speeches, inciting comments and indecency.
